Either way, I couldn't be more ecstatic about how these gluten-free spice muffins turned out!
Each one is light and fluffy, but not crumbly... a perfect muffin. Filled with nourishing ingredients like Chobani Greek yogurt, honey and even chickpeas, these muffins are extremely satisfying.
And let's just talk about the streusel topping, shall we? I went light on it, because of its ingredients, but it added a wonderful sweet crunch. Just combine butter, coconut sugar, dark chocolate, pistachios and additional brown rice flour... and voila, fancy (and beautiful) muffins!
